The launch of 5G wireless communication technologies and its integration with emerging technologies has revealed new technical requirements/challenges. Some challenges include data rate, latency, capacity, and quality of service. 6G wireless communication will overcome these challenges by providing a peak data rate of 1000 gigabits per second, latency of less than 100 microseconds, 50 times the peak data rate, and 1/10th the latency of 5G. Technologies like machine learning that are still in their infancy will act as essential components of the 6G ecosystem and enable a decentralized architecture without a centralized controller. The centralized control will help in achieving low latency. The underlying technologies of 6G will fundamentally differ from the fifth generation (5G). While upgrading backbone cable plants in the LAN to support 10 Gig has been going on for several years since the release of the 10GBASE-SR standard for fiber, many enterprise businesses did not previously require these types of speeds, until now. Data centers are rapidly migrating to 25, 40 and even 100 Gigabit speeds to accommodate an increasing amount of virtualized servers that host more applications than ever before and vast volumes of data that needs to be accessed, transmitted and stored. At the same time, the demand for high speed transmission in the LAN is at an all-time high for both wired and wireless connections. While many larger enterprise businesses like universities and financial institutions have already upgraded their LAN backbones, there are still a vast number of others that are just now coming to the realization that 1 gigabit speeds are no longer adequate
